Labyrinth Resources (ASX:LRL) announced a high grade 95,710oz resource ( open pit and underground) at the Comet Vale project in WA.

The resource, which includes an Indicated component of 42,000oz @ 10g/t gold, is open in all directions “demonstrating substantial growth potential through both the near-mine and regional drilling”.

Jupiter Energy (ASX:JPR) has achieved first export sales from its Kazakh oil project, which is currently producing ~90 tonnes (~675 barrels) per day from five wells.

It is expected that 50% of April production will be sold into the export market and the remaining 50% sold into the domestic market, via Jupiter’s newly formed JV vehicle.
